fre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

sas數(shù)據(jù)步課件(已修改)

2025-08-30 14:54 本頁(yè)面
 

【正文】 華中科技大學(xué)公衛(wèi)學(xué)院 流行病與衛(wèi)生統(tǒng)計(jì)系 SAS數(shù)據(jù)集 1 SAS應(yīng)用 一、 SAS數(shù)據(jù)集的概念和結(jié)構(gòu) SAS是處理數(shù)據(jù)的軟件 , SAS處理的數(shù)據(jù)必須以數(shù)據(jù)集的形式出現(xiàn) 。 數(shù)據(jù)集是指使用 SAS系統(tǒng)產(chǎn)生的一類(lèi)具有特殊結(jié)構(gòu)的文件 , 此類(lèi)文件是數(shù)據(jù)的特殊組織形式 。 ? SAS data sets SAS數(shù)據(jù)集? SAS所能做的任何工作都離不開(kāi) SAS數(shù)據(jù)集 , 所以可以這樣說(shuō) , SAS數(shù)據(jù)集是SAS系統(tǒng)的 ? 心臟 ? 。 2 數(shù)據(jù)步功能: 1. 將輸入數(shù)據(jù)轉(zhuǎn)化為 SAS數(shù)據(jù)集; 2. 編輯數(shù)據(jù)集中的數(shù)據(jù) , 檢查和修改數(shù)據(jù)中的錯(cuò)誤 , 計(jì)算新變量等; 3. 根據(jù)用戶要求的格式打印數(shù)據(jù) , 或?qū)?shù)據(jù)寫(xiě)入磁盤(pán)文件; 4. 從已有的數(shù)據(jù)集中通過(guò)取子集 、 合并 、 更新等方法產(chǎn)生新的數(shù)據(jù)集 。 3 華中科技大學(xué)公衛(wèi)學(xué)院 流行病與衛(wèi)生統(tǒng)計(jì)系 第一節(jié) SAS數(shù)據(jù)集的建立 4 1. SAS數(shù)據(jù)集的名稱 在建立數(shù)據(jù)集時(shí) , 你必須給它命名 。SAS數(shù)據(jù)集的名字可以有 18個(gè)字符 , 必須以字母或下劃線開(kāi)始 , 后面跟英文字母 、數(shù)字或下劃線 , 中間不能有空格 。 下面這些均是合法的 SAS數(shù)據(jù)集名: SALES _TAXES _88FILES QUARTER_1 5 SAS數(shù)據(jù)集組成要素 1.?dāng)?shù)據(jù)值 數(shù)據(jù)值是構(gòu)成 SAS數(shù)據(jù)集的基本單元,數(shù)據(jù)值分為數(shù)值型數(shù)據(jù)、字符型數(shù)據(jù)和日期型數(shù)據(jù)三種類(lèi)型。 2.觀測(cè)值 描述一個(gè)觀察單位(如一個(gè)人,一個(gè)地區(qū),一年)特征的一系列數(shù)據(jù)值稱為觀測(cè)值。 3.變量 具有相同特征的數(shù)據(jù)值的集合組成了變量。 4.?dāng)?shù)據(jù)集 數(shù)據(jù)集是由若干個(gè)觀測(cè)值組成的集合。 6 SAS數(shù)據(jù)集的結(jié)構(gòu) OBS NAME SEX SI S2 S3 1 WANGBO M 79 78 92 2 HEWEI M 96 69 87 3 YANJIN F 98 87 93 4 MALIV F 88 85 90 5 HAVHUI M 73 93 89 6 ZHOUBIN M 96 87 89 7 LIMIN F 87 93 90 8 SUNYI F 79 88 76 7 數(shù)據(jù)值 變量 觀測(cè)值 2. SAS數(shù)據(jù)集分為兩種 臨時(shí)數(shù)據(jù)集 temporary SAS data sets 永久數(shù)據(jù)集 permanent SAS data sets 所謂臨時(shí)數(shù)據(jù)集 , 是指本次 SAS作業(yè)( SAS session) 中臨時(shí)建立并只在本次 SAS作業(yè)中有效的臨時(shí)性的數(shù)據(jù)集 , 退出 SAS, 臨時(shí)數(shù)據(jù)集即消失 。 所謂永久數(shù)據(jù)集是存貯在外部存貯介質(zhì)( 硬盤(pán) 、 軟盤(pán)等 ) 上的數(shù)據(jù)集 , 不刪除可以長(zhǎng)久存在 , 反復(fù)使用 。 8 SAS數(shù)據(jù)集 —— 臨時(shí)數(shù)據(jù)集 Data aa。 Input id x1 x2 x3$@@。 Cards。 1 153 45 m 2 145 37 f 3 150 40 m 。 Proc print。 Run。 SAS數(shù)據(jù)集 —— 永久數(shù)據(jù)集 Libname m’d: \gw’。 Data 。 Input id x1 x2 x3$@@。 Cards。 1 153 45 m 2 145 37 f 3 150 40 m 。 Run。 SAS數(shù)據(jù)集 — 調(diào)用永久數(shù)據(jù)集 ? libname m39。d:\gw39。 ? run。 /*建永久數(shù)據(jù)集 */ ? data bb。 ? set 。 /*調(diào)用永久數(shù)據(jù)集 */ ? proc print。 ? run。 3.一點(diǎn)說(shuō)明 建立或調(diào)用一個(gè)永久數(shù)據(jù)集 , 必須使用兩級(jí)名規(guī)則 。 第一級(jí)名又叫庫(kù)邏輯名 ( libref) ,用來(lái)表示數(shù)據(jù)集的目錄路徑;第二級(jí)名是數(shù)據(jù)集名 ( filename) , 用來(lái)區(qū)別其它的數(shù)據(jù)集 。一級(jí)名與二級(jí)名用 ? .? 分開(kāi) , 例如:在以 CLINIC為邏輯名的目錄路徑下有一永久數(shù)據(jù)集 ADMIT, 調(diào)用此數(shù)據(jù)集時(shí) ,要用兩級(jí)名 , ↓ ↓ libref filename 12 SAS系統(tǒng)給每個(gè)臨時(shí)數(shù)據(jù)集自動(dòng)給予一個(gè)叫 ? work? 的一級(jí)名 , 但在引用臨時(shí)數(shù)據(jù)集時(shí) , 不用加 ? work? 字樣( 生成臨時(shí)數(shù)據(jù)集時(shí) , 在 LOG窗口可以看到臨時(shí)數(shù)據(jù)集的全稱 ) 。 故在實(shí)際應(yīng)用中 , 使用單名的數(shù)據(jù)集都是臨時(shí)數(shù)據(jù)集 , 使用兩級(jí)名的數(shù)據(jù)集則是永久數(shù)據(jù)集 。 13 二 、 建立 SAS數(shù)據(jù)集 14 SAS語(yǔ)句的書(shū)寫(xiě)規(guī)則: 1. 以 SAS關(guān)鍵詞( SAS keyword)開(kāi)頭, 關(guān)鍵詞可以大寫(xiě)字母可以小寫(xiě); 2. 以分號(hào)( semicolon)結(jié)尾; 3. 可以從任意行或列開(kāi)始或結(jié)束; 4. 一條語(yǔ)句可以連續(xù)寫(xiě)多行; 5. 多條語(yǔ)句可以在同一行; 6. 字與字間( words)用空格分隔; 7. 程序的最后要有“ run”語(yǔ)句; DATA CLASS; INPUT NAME $ SEX $ S1 S2 S2; CARDS; WANGBO M 79 78 92 HEWEI M 96 69 87 ; RUN; 1. 臨時(shí)數(shù)據(jù)集的建立 ( 1) 程序的基本結(jié)構(gòu): DATA 語(yǔ)句; INPUT 語(yǔ)句; 用于數(shù)據(jù)步的其它語(yǔ)句 …… CARDS; 若干數(shù)據(jù)行 …… ; RUN; 15 A 直接通過(guò)鍵盤(pán)輸入數(shù)據(jù) 16 OBS NAME SEX SI S2 S3 1 WANGBO M 79 78 92 2 HEWEI M 96 69 87 3 YANJIN F 98 87 93 4 MALIV F 88 85 90 5 HAVHUI M 73 93 89 6 ZHOUBIN M 96 87 89 7 LIMIN F 87 93 90 8 SUNYI F 79 88 76 例 17 DATA CLASS; INPUT NAME $ SEX $ S1 S2 S2; CARDS; WANGBO M 79 78 92 HEWEI M 96 69 87 YANJIN F 98 87 93 MALIN F 88 85 90 HANHUI M 73 93 89 ZHOUBIN M 96 87 89 LIMIN F 87 93 90 SUNYI F 79 88 76 ; RUN; ( 1) DATA語(yǔ)句 語(yǔ)句格式 : DATA [數(shù)據(jù)集名表 ] [選擇項(xiàng) ]; 18 DATA語(yǔ)句的作用是表明數(shù)據(jù)步的開(kāi)始,并給出所建數(shù)據(jù)集的名稱。 數(shù)據(jù)集名必須以英文字母開(kāi)始,最長(zhǎng)不超過(guò) 8個(gè)字符。 數(shù)據(jù)集名可以是一個(gè)或者多個(gè)。 DATA語(yǔ)句中,如果不給出數(shù)據(jù)集名,則 SAS系統(tǒng)自動(dòng)以 DATA DATA2等依次命名所建立的數(shù)據(jù)集。 DATA class; ( 2) INPUT語(yǔ)句 19 功能:讀取 CARDS語(yǔ)句后的數(shù)據(jù),或從外部數(shù)據(jù)文件讀數(shù)據(jù),并將讀入的數(shù)據(jù)賦給“ INPUT”后相應(yīng)的變量; [變量說(shuō)明 ]主要有以下三種格式: ? 自由格式 ? 列輸入格式 ? 格式化輸入 格式: INPUT [變量說(shuō)明 ]; INPUT NAME $ SEX $ S1 S2 S3; 1) 自由輸入格式 是最簡(jiǎn)單的數(shù)據(jù)輸入方法 , 它只需要在 INPUT語(yǔ)句中按順序列變量名 , 而不必了解輸入記錄中數(shù)據(jù)占有哪些列 。 語(yǔ)句格式: INPUT 變量名 [$]; INPUT NAME $ SEX $ S1 S2 S2; 注意: ① INPUT語(yǔ)句中列出的變量的順序與相應(yīng)的輸入數(shù)據(jù)的 順序必須一致 , $指明左邊的變量為字符型變量 。 ② 使用列表輸入數(shù)據(jù)必須通過(guò)空格分隔 。 ③ 字符型數(shù)據(jù)的長(zhǎng)度缺省值是 8個(gè)字節(jié) , 如果超過(guò) 8位可使用 LENGTH、 ATTRIB、INFORMAT語(yǔ)句重新定義字符串的寬度 。 20 ?列表輸入格式舉例 DATA CLASS; INPUT NAME $ SEX $ S1 S2 S2; CARDS; WANGBO M 79 78 92 HEWEI M 96 69 87 YANJIN F 98 87 93 MALIN F 88 85 90 HANHUI M 73 93 89 ZHOUBIN M 96 87 89 LIMIN F 87 93 90 SUNYI F 79 88 76 RUN; 21 2) 列輸入格式 在 INPUT語(yǔ)句變量名后須指出相應(yīng)的變量值所處的列號(hào)范圍 。 語(yǔ)句格式: INPUT 變量名 [$] 開(kāi)始列 [終止列 ]; 開(kāi)始列 指明該變量要讀取的數(shù)據(jù)的起始列號(hào) 終止列 指明該變量要讀取的數(shù)據(jù)的終止列號(hào) 例如: INPUT NAME $ 18 S1 1213; 該語(yǔ)句從每個(gè)輸入數(shù)據(jù)行的第 1列至第 8列讀 取字符型變量 NAME的值 , 從第 12列至第 13 列讀取數(shù)值型變量 S1的值 。 22 列輸入的特點(diǎn): ① 適用于所有輸入行中的同一變量值位于相同的列時(shí); ② 輸入值可以任何順序讀入 , 無(wú)須考慮它們?cè)谳斎胗涗浿械奈慌Z; 例如: INPUT S1 1213 NAME $ 18; ③ 字符型數(shù)據(jù)可包含空格; ④ 字符型數(shù)據(jù)可以最多到 200個(gè)字符長(zhǎng); ⑤ 可讀取全部或部分?jǐn)?shù)值 。 例如: INPUT ID 1015 GROUP 13;第 10至 15列為 ID的值 , ID的第 4個(gè)數(shù)字即第 13列又是 GROOP的值 。 23 ?列輸入格式舉例 DATA CLASS; INPUT NAME $ 18 SEX $ 10 S1 1213 S2 1516 S2 1819; CARDS; WANGBO M 79 78 92 HEWEI M 96 69 87 YANJIN F 98 87 93 MALIN F 88 85 90 HANHUI M 73 93 89 ZHOUBIN M 96 87 89 LIMIN F 87 93 90 SUNYI F 79 88 76 RUN; 24 3) 格式化輸入 在 INPUT語(yǔ)句變量后給出一個(gè)輸入格式 , 用來(lái)說(shuō)明變量類(lèi)型和字段的寬度 。 語(yǔ)句格式: INPUT 變量名 [$] SAS輸入格式; 上面的 SAS輸入格式包括一個(gè)園點(diǎn) ( .) 或以( .) 結(jié)尾 。 如 , $10., 。格式化輸入特別適用于讀入日期型變
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
公安備案圖鄂ICP備17016276號(hào)-1